Department:COM | Biochemistry & Molecular MiahDepartment's Website: Summary of Job Duties:***This position is for three to five months only!***This position in the Miah Laboratory at the University of Arkansas for Medical Sciences on Triple Negative Breast Cancer (TNBC) to study the role of non-Receptor Protein Tyrosine kinases (nRTKs) in TNBC; how nRTKs maneuver signal transduction pathways in TNBC to promote tumorigenesis and metastasis. The lab will undertake an interdisciplinary approach combining biochemical, molecular genetics, genomic and proteomics approaches in cell lines, mice, and human samples to achieve the research goals. The overarching goal of this research is to identify a druggable biomarker to yield a new avenue to study and treat TNBC with precision medicine therapies. This position involves studying the role of nRTKs and signal transduction pathways in TNBC using cell lines, tumor tissue samples and mouse models. The candidate will receive training in to progress towards an independent career. The expectation will be that the postdoc will obtain new data related to the above studies and, in cooperation and consultation with the supervisor, write manuscripts and grant proposals to the NIH or other local, national or international funding sources to obtain resources to expand studies and develop new independent lines of research.
